The thighs are a difficult area to treat. If you just have fullness, then liposuction may be the best option. However if you have loose skin, then you likely need a thigh lift.

Thighplasty is a procedure to tighten and improve the overall appearance of thighs. Candidates for this procedure have loss of skin elasticity in the thigh or have thighs with a saggy, dimpled or flabby appearance which improves dramatically if the loose skin is lifted.

How can I tighten loose skin on my thighs?

Although muscle tone can be tightened with targeted exercises, surgery is the only solution to remove excess skin. Surgical removal of excess skin and tissue with a thigh lift can slim the lines of the inner and outer thighs.

What is the best skin tightening treatment for inner thighs?

Ultherapy was recently shown to provide significant tightening of the skin on thighs and knee areas, with improvements that continue for up to six months. Further research is ongoing determining the benefit of the Ulthera device on the body, but it appears to work best in thinner skin areas.Dec 9, 2015

Is RF skin tightening worth it?

RF therapy uses low energy radiation to heat the deep layer of your skin called the dermis. This heat stimulates the production of collagen to help improve signs of wrinkles and sagging skin. Research has found that RF therapy is usually safe and can be effective at treating mild or moderate signs of aging.Jul 17, 2020

How long does it take to see results from RF skin tightening?

You may start to see changes to your skin right away. The most significant improvements to skin tightness will come later. Skin can keep getting tighter up to six months after the radiofrequency treatment.May 19, 2021

How do antioxidants help skin?

Antioxidants are also known for their beneficial effect on your skin health. They may promote the production of collagen and elastin, which are necessary for your skin’s youthful elasticity. Antioxidants and antioxidative enzymes may help you fight loose skin and wrinkles by neutralizing reactive oxygen species (ROS), these are compounds that can activate pathways that eventually degrade collagen. Most people get enough antioxidants through their diet. Here are the antioxidants that you consume daily with some foods, drinks, and nutritional supplements: 1 Vitamins A, C, D, and E 2 Coenzyme Q10 3 Epigallocatechin gallate (EGCG) 4 Selenium 5 Zink

Non-ablative laser skin tightening typically works by heating the layers of the skin, which in turn boosts the production of collagen and elastin, allowing the skin to naturally tighten within the designated treatment area.

What is an IPL laser?

Intense Pulsed Light (IPL) treatment, also known as “Forever Young BBL” or a photo-facial, is a rejuvenating, non-ablative laser that improves the tone and texture of a patient’s skin through the use of targeted wavelengths of light . IPL is designed to use a variety of different wavelengths of light which are then scattered to address a variety of skin concerns. Depending on the wavelengths of light chosen, pigment cells, hair follicles, or blood vessels are targeted and destroyed. This in turn can help to treat a variety of different skin issues, including skin laxity, fine lines and wrinkles, pigmentation or brown spots, rosacea or redness, sun damage, freckles, acne scars, laser hair removal, and uneven skin tone or texture.

What is Velashape elos?

Both VelaShape and VelaSmooth use electrical-optical synergy (elos technology) to tighten the skin on the thighs. This technology is a combination of radiofrequency energy, infrared energy, vacuum, and mechanical massage that increase collagen growth and improve skin tone. They are also effective in reducing the appearance of cellulite.

Why is skin tightening non-invasive?

Non-invasive skin tightening procedures These procedures are called non-invasive because they leave your skin intact. You won’t have a puncture wound, incision, or raw skin afterward. You may see some temporary redness and swelling, but that’s usually the only sign that you had a procedure.

How long does it take for collagen to lift?

Bottom line: The heat can cause your body to produce more collagen. With 1 treatment, most people see modest lifting and tightening within 2 to 6 months. You may get more benefit from having additional treatments.

Is laser resurfacing good for skin?

Bottom line: Laser resurfacing can tighten skin, usually better than any other skin-tightening procedure. It can also diminish fine lines, wrinkles, and dark spots on the skin, such as age spots. The tradeoff is that it requires downtime and has a greater risk of possible side effects, such as scarring.

Who can perform skin tightening?

In general, completely non-invasive skin tightening treatments can be safely performed by a licensed, trained aesthetician or registered nurse working under physician supervision. Subdermal treatments that require an incision, such as EmbraceRF, should be performed only by a qualified cosmetic surgeon or provider with equivalent training and experience.

How does non surgical skin tightening work?

In general, non-surgical skin tightening procedures work by using targeted energy to heat deeper layers of skin, which stimulates collagen and elastin production and gradually improves skin tone and texture. Some treatments also affect fibrous tissue to help smooth cellulite.

What is RF treatment?

Radiofrequency (RF) treatments. Radiofrequency (RF) energy can also be used to heat the skin and trigger collagen production. In contrast to ultrasound, RF focuses on epidermal layers to achieve a firmer, smoother appearance. Brand name treatments include Profound® RF, Exilis®, Morpheus8®, and Thermage®.

How does ultrasound tightening work?

Some skin tightening treatments use focused ultrasound energy, which heats skin at specific depths ( up to 5mm deep) and locations to induce collagen production and help skin become firmer. Treatments are delivered via a handheld device, which transmits the ultrasound waves through the skin’s surface.
